On this Peace day, 21st September 2007, we Anam Prem people visited the Consuls of various countries in Mumbai and handed over our letter and also flowers to them.
The letter is enclosed herewith

Anam Prem also took Peace Procession in Mumbai and Sawantwadi. In Mumbai we took Peace yatra and everybody observed silence. We also displayed boards for Peace.

UN Resolution UN/A/RES/55/282 fixes the date of the International Day of Peace on 21 September and calls for a Global Ceasefire on that Day. The International Day of Peace, as envisaged by the United Nations General Assembly, provides an opportunity for individuals, organizations and nations to create practical acts of Peace on a shared date.
